The RG670MH is an RG series solid body electric guitar model introduced by Ibanez in 1994. It was made in Japan by FujiGen.
The RG670MH features a mahogany body bolted to a maple Wizard neck with a 24-fret Bolivian rosewood fingerboard with pearloid dot position makers. Components include Ibanez Quantum pickups with a pair of humbuckers mounted in metal pickup rings flanking a single-coil, a Lo Pro Edge double locking tremolo bridge with a locking nut and Gotoh tuning machines.
The RG670 is a similar model with a light ash body.
The RG670MH was available only in Japan and was produced for only one year.
